Apr-22-09  Amarande: I'm foggy on the ending here ... Obviously 21 Qxf3 is mandatory, but 21 ... Bxg4 now seems to be countered by 22 g3, 21 ... Rf8 doesn't have the secondary threat necessary to win, and if 21 ... Qh2+ 22 Kf1 and I don't seem to see a continuation?
Apr-23-09  Shams: <Amarande> white missed it too, else he would have played 20.f3 defending.

Black wins thusly: 21.♕xf3 ♗h2+! 22.♔f1 ♗xg4 23.g3 ♕h5

Apr-23-09  ounos: 20. f3 wasn't much of a defence in view of 20. ...Bd4+
Apr-23-09  Shams: <ounos> ugh, I should look at my suggested alternatives for more than five seconds I guess.
Jul-06-13  jerseybob: 21.Qf3,Qh2+ 22.Kf1,Bd7 seems to do the job.
